CVE-2017-7532: Medium severity Moodle moodle vulnerability

Published Jul 17, 2017
·
Updated

In Moodle 3.x, course creators are able to change system default settings for courses.

Frequently Asked Questions

1

What is the severity of CVE-2017-7532?

The severity of CVE-2017-7532 is considered medium, as it allows course creators to manipulate system default settings.

2

How do I fix CVE-2017-7532?

To mitigate CVE-2017-7532, update Moodle to a version later than 3.3.1 where this vulnerability has been addressed.

3

Who is affected by CVE-2017-7532?

CVE-2017-7532 affects Moodle versions 3.1.0 through 3.3.1, allowing unauthorized changes by course creators.

4

What are the implications of CVE-2017-7532?

The implications of CVE-2017-7532 include potential exposure to unauthorized configuration changes in course settings.

5

Is there a workaround for CVE-2017-7532?

A possible workaround for CVE-2017-7532 is to limit course creator permissions until a patch is applied.
